When customers report login failures after the Nortella user-module split, first check whether their account was migrated to the new Userline service. CI runs a migration-parity suite nightly; failures there usually mean stale fixtures, not real regressions, so verify against staging before escalating. Escalations go to the Platform rota, not the monolith team. The currently validated pipeline run is recorded below.

pipeline stamp: htk9_ce63042d9

Q4 Planning Note — Branch Managers

Our largest account, Dornway Logistics, now represents 38% of regional revenue, up from 24% last year. This concentration exposes branches to significant downside if their volumes shift. For the coming quarter, prioritize pipeline diversification: each branch should add at least two mid-tier accounts. Discounting to Dornway requires regional sign-off. Further detail on our mitigation plans is set out below.

board note of bajop-yaweg: The western region missed its Pelys quota by 58.0 percent last quarter. Pelysek Foods plans to raise the Belius list price by 44.0 percent in July. The steering committee signed off on a budget of $133.8 million for Project Pelax. The renewal with Zoraelix Systems closes at $61.9 million a year, 12.7 percent above the last contract.

Minutes — management meeting, Halverton office. Attendees: product, finance, operations leads. Agreed: the Quillbrook appliance line enters end-of-sale next quarter, end-of-support eighteen months later. Finance to model writedown of remaining inventory and update revenue forecasts. Operations to wind down the Marwick assembly cell. Customer migration credits approved in principle, capped per account. Communications embargoed until the forecast is final. The confidential direction driving this decision is recorded below.

confidential, bahof-yaweg: Headcount on the Kaseth team goes from 32 to 109 by the end of January. Gross margin on Kaseth came in at 46 percent against a plan of 45 percent.

Meeting notes — Lockerly access flow review, sprint 14

Discussed the laundry-locker unlock sequence for the Bramford pilot. Agreed the one-time PIN must expire after 90 seconds, not five minutes, and that the retry counter resets only on successful pickup. Reviewer should check the state machine in locker_session.rb carefully: the ABANDONED state can currently be re-entered, which double-fires the notification hook. Fix is in branch pin-expiry-tighten. Questions on intended behaviour go to the flow owner named below.

named custodian: Brivan Eliath Quenox Frador